Bonus Amount: State the exact amount of the bonus being awarded. For instance, “You will receive a performance bonus of $5,000.” Rationale for Award: Provide a brief explanation of why the bonus is being awarded. This could include a summary of the employee's achievements and their impact on the organization.

Dear Employee Name, We are pleased to present you with your year award in the amount of $__. This bonus award reflects your excellent performance, the contributions you made and the goals achieved on behalf of Company Name during the past year.

If you're asking for a bonus for a specific project, provide facts and figures about the outcome of the project and how it exceeded the stakeholders' requirements. If you're asking for a bonus for more general reasons, offer details about why you deserve it.

How to write a bonus letter Address the letter. In the beginning of the letter, label and address it like you start any correspondence with your team. Announce the bonus. Give details. Congratulate them. End the letter. Use a simple tone. Keep it brief. Consider a template.

Ask about the bonus. regardless of the relationship you have with the owner(s), it is fine to ask, in an appropriate way. Stop by and express how nice it is to see the company continue to grow, having another banner year, then ask if bonuses would continue this year.

Yes, it is feasible to ask for a higher base salary instead of a bonus during salary negotiations. Here are some points to consider when making this request: Stability: A higher base salary provides more financial stability than a bonus, which can vary year to year. Emphasize your preference for consistent income.

Details to Include: Reason for Bonus: Clearly state the extraordinary contribution or innovation that is being recognized. Amount of Bonus: Specify the bonus amount being awarded. Specific Achievements: Detail the specific achievements or contributions that led to the award.

Be confident in your approach and ask for what you think you're worth. Your employer will ask you what you think the bonus you're requesting should be, so don't go all shy here. State your case, what you want and why. Be prepared for some negotiation, so have a figure in mind that you will accept.

An annual bonus of 5-10% of your yearly salary is standard in a lot of industries, just as a 5-10% annual raise is considered standard. However, if you work on commission, you may see a significantly higher percentage.
